Visitors to Calloway House must be met at the front desk by their host and remain escorted at all times. New starters should never let a visitor follow them through the staff gates, even someone they recognise. All visitors sign the register and wear a red lanyard while on site. If your host badge has not yet been issued, you can open the staff gate with the code below.

badge for badup-kahif: bdg-LHI-9

Action item from the Bramblewick outage review: split the user module out of the Orchardcore monolith. The shared session cache caused cascading lockups when profile writes spiked, and we cannot rate-limit it independently while it lives in-process. Target: extract auth, profile, and preferences into a standalone service behind the existing gateway, with a feature flag for rollback. Owner assigned; two-sprint estimate. The migration plan and dependency map are on the planning page.

runbook for badug-kadup: https://confluence.zemvarlabs.internal/projects/browse/display/projects/bd1b

MEMO — Varntide Systems Board

Effective Q3 we shift all Klarro subscriptions to annual billing. Monthly plans close to new customers on rollout day. Finance projects smoother cash flow and lower churn handling. Renewal terms grandfathered for twelve months. Objections from the Dellmore branch were resolved. Full transition owned by R. Casker. The confidential planning note follows below.

board note of kageg-bahof: The renewal with Holwynax Holdings closes at $2 million a year, 5 percent below the last contract. Project Ulaath slips by two quarters because of the supplier delay.

// Rate limiting for the Hollowgate internal API gateway.
// Limits apply per service token, not per host, so NAT'd callers
// share a bucket. Bursts are allowed up to the bucket size; sustained
// overage returns 429 with a retry hint. Review the values below
// before approving changes.

constants for tageg-kagag:
QUOTAS = {
    "kelax": 495,
    "istath": 366,
    "tammir": 108,
    "novdor": 730,
    "casax": 816,
    "quenael": 874,
    "pelius": 403,
}

As part of Project Loomshift, we are migrating all scheduled cron jobs at Fernvale Systems into the Cadenza workflow engine. During the transition, some jobs run in both places; always check the migration tracker before retrying anything manually. The current status of each job, including ownership, is maintained on this page:

wiki page, tahaf-tajog: https://jira.ordindyn.corp/pipeline